'The Maitland': Boutique Refinement

Conjunctional Agent Nicholas Gibson 0437 000 011

Meticulously crafted by Bruce Henderson Architects and flawlessly delivered by Gibson Developments. This brand new, three bedroom, 'The Maitland' residence combines a house-like sense of proportion with a superior level of appointment and a peerless lifestyle on the cusp of Malvern Village's thriving café, restaurant and retail scene. Distinguished by quality at every juncture and brimming with natural light under soaring ceilings, this is a carefully curated, low maintenance home to appeal to the most discerning of downsizers and lock-and-leavers.

Expansive natural stone benches are perfectly complemented by a suite of Miele appliances including a five-burner cooktop as well as an integrated Fisher & Paykel refrigerator and volumes of soft close cabinetry in a spacious kitchen / dining / living where two sets of double-glazed siding doors open to a vast entertainers' terrace. Both the main bedroom's ensuite and the central bathroom are fully-tiled showpieces with sub-floor heating, plus there is secure video entry, CCTV, non-stacker basement parking for two vehicles and a storage cage, as well as a large concealed laundry, built-in robes, great storage, double block-out blinds, premium lighting and zoned reverse cycle heating / air conditioning.

Walk to a first-class selection of cafes, bars, restaurants and shopping on Malvern Road, as well as city-bound trams, trains from Tooronga Railway Station and Harold Holt Swim Centre which is just around the corner.

A block's planning zone defines how that land can be used and what can be built on it.
A right to use a part of land owned by another person for a specific purpose. The most common forms of easements are for services, such as water, electricity or sewerage.
The value of a block of land without any buildings, landscaping, paths, or fences. This is different to the block's market value. A block's unimproved value is used to calculate rates and land tax charges.
This represents the shape of the geographical land. Closely spaced contour lines represent a steep slope. Widely spaced lines represent a gentle slope.
